Key Information
Short Description
Lifren 10mg Tablet is a muscarinic antagonist used to treat overactive bladder, relieving symptoms like frequent urination, urgent need to urinate, and inability to control urination.

Introduction
Lifren 10mg Tablet is advised to take it in a dose and duration as per prescription. It can be taken with or without food. Swallow the medicine as a whole without crushing or chewing it. You should not stop taking the medicine without consulting the doctor as it may lead to the worsening of your symptoms. The course of the treatment should be completed for better efficacy of the medicine. Some common side effects of this medicine are dry mouth, constipation, nausea, and urinary tract infection. To avoid or cope up with the side effects, you must drink plenty of water. It may also lead to blurry vision or dizziness, so it is advised to avoid driving while on the medication. Before receiving the treatment, inform your doctor if you are on any medication for any other health condition. If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, tell your doctor prior to the treatment. Patients with liver or kidney disease must be cautious while receiving the prescription and they must receive regular follow-ups as per the doctor’s advice.
Directions for Use
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Lifren 10mg Tablet may be taken with or without food, but it is better to take it at a fixed time.
How it works
Lifren 10mg Tablet is an antimuscarinic. It works by relaxing muscles of the urinary bladder to prevent frequent, urgent or uncontrolled urination.
Quick Tips
Lifren 10mg Tablet helps you to have better control over your urination by relaxing your bladder which increases its capacity to hold urine, thereby reducing the need to pass urine. It may cause blurred vision, fatigue and sleepiness. Be cautious while driving or doing anything that requires focus. It may cause dry mouth. Try chewing on sugar-free gum or taking small sips of water. Avoid caffeine, alcohol or carbonated drinks as they can worsen your symptoms. Do not stop taking this medicine if you do not notice an improvement in your symptoms as it may take some time for your bladder to adapt and your symptoms to improve.

Frequently asked questions
How soon can I expect Lifren 10mg Tablet to start working?
Lifren 10mg Tablet may show improvement in symptoms of overactive bladder within a week, but maximum benefits may be seen up to 4 weeks after starting the medication. This timeframe may vary from person to person.
When should I take Lifren 10mg Tablet?
Take Lifren 10mg Tablet exactly as prescribed by your doctor, usually once daily at the same time. It can be taken with or without food.
Who should not take Lifren 10mg Tablet?
Lifren 10mg Tablet is for adults only and should be prescribed by a doctor. Avoid taking it if you are allergic to this medication, have difficulty emptying your bladder (urinary retention), delayed stomach emptying (gastric obstruction), or increased eye pressure with vision problems (narrow angle glaucoma).
Can Lifren 10mg Tablet cause dementia?
In rare cases, Lifren 10mg Tablet may cause confusion and hallucinations. Although some studies suggest a possible link to dementia, this has not been conclusively confirmed.
What should I avoid while taking Lifren 10mg Tablet?
Avoid driving or operating heavy machinery if you experience drowsiness or blurred vision while taking Lifren 10mg Tablet, as it can be hazardous.
What is overactive bladder and how does it affect me?
Overactive bladder is a condition where the nerves direct your bladder to empty even when it's not full. This may lead to symptoms like urinary frequency, urgency, and incontinence (leakage).
Do I need to take Lifren 10mg Tablet daily?
Yes, take Lifren 10mg Tablet once daily as advised by your doctor. Do not stop taking it even if you don't see immediate results, but consult with your doctor instead.
